1. Given;
y = x2 + 3x + 2
Dierentiating with respect to x;
\(\frac{dy}{dx}\) = 2x + 3
Dierentiating again with respect to x;
\(\frac{d^2y}{dx^2}\) = 2
2. Given;
y = tan-1x
Differentiating with respect to x; \(\frac{dy}{dx} = \frac{1}{1+x^2}\)
Differentiating again with respect to x;
\(\frac{d^2y}{dx^2}\) = -\(\frac{1}{(1+x^2)^2}.2x\).
